RATING
Ratings are our specially trained personnel, fully prepared and ready for jobs that need doing anywhere in the world. As you develop new skills and trades, you’ll be eligible for promotion and the pay rise that goes with it.
At any time in your career, if you show the right commitment, skills and academic ability, you may even get the chance to become a Commissioned Officer.
Able Rate:
Whatever your job, you’ll start your career as an Able Rate.
Leading Hand:
With some experience and further training, you could be promoted to Leading Hand, often managing a small group of Able Rates.
Petty Officer:
As a Petty Officer, you’ll have responsibility for certain sections within your department.
Chief Petty Officer:
The rank of Chief Petty Officer gives you more responsibility in the team, with the officers relying heavily on your skills and experience.
Warrant Officer 2:
Known as a WO2, you’ll provide a crucial leadership link between your officers and the ratings serving under you.
Warrant Officer 1:
This is the highest rank you can achieve as a rating.
